Overview The Centerline Atlantic, Inc. Crewing Coordinator organizes all aspects of crew changes. Responsibilities Book travel arrangements for appropriate crew change dates and locations. Minimize travel expenses through planning and utilization of any/all available discounts with the Travel department. Ensure tugs and barges are properly crewed and operated as per vessel COI’s and company policy. Maintain a calendar tracking crew member’s time off (Vacation, sick leave, etc) and ensure the Company has proper crewing. Keep crew schedule updated and operations apprised of any fleet needs. Assists Dispatchers in scheduling crew changes and calling crewmembers. Serve as the primary point of contact for crew members, addressing their concerns and inquiries. Collaborate with operations, HR, and management to align crewing strategies with organizational goals. Resolve conflicts or issues related to crew assignments and logistics. Maintain up-to-date crew records in the crewing management system. Generate reports on crew movements, availability, and training status for management review. Ensure compliance with relevant maritime regulations, company policies, and flag state requirements. Verify that crew members possess required certifications, licenses, and medical clearances. Help track and manage crew certifications and ensure timely renewals. Assist with the onboarding process, ensuring all new hires receive necessary documentation, training, and certifications as needed. Other duties as assigned. Company Overview Centerline Logistics is a leading provider of marine transportation services in the United States. Centerline Logistics operates on the United States West Coast (including Alaska and Hawaii), United States East Coast (including Puerto Rico), the United States Gulf Coast and the Mississippi River System. Services provided include the transportation and storage of petroleum products, tanker escort, ship assist, the transportation of general cargo and rescue towing. Centerline Logistics is the parent company of eight businesses specializing in marine services and a bulk liquids terminal business. Centerline Logistics provides accounting, administrative, human resources, safety and environmental services, and other support to the subsidiary companies.
